Automatisation
industrielle
Cours + TP
Pr. BOTROS Kamal
Ce support est destiné aux étudiants de l’option ESA & AII ; Licence ; Master et Formations continues
[email protected] /kamalbotros
PLAN DE COURS
00 03 06
INTRO Câblage d ’API Traitement
DUCTION analogique
01 04 07
Systèmes Programmation OUTRO
automatises des API DUCTION
02 05
Automates Traduction ‘SFC’
programmables vers ‘LD’
INTRODUCTION
Les automates programmables industriels sont apparus à la fin
des années soixante, à la demande de l’industrie automobile
américaine, qui réclamait plus d’adaptabilité de leurs systèmes de
commande. Les couts de l’électronique permettant alors de
remplacer avantageusement les technologies actuelles.
▪ Logique câblée:
Auparavant l’utilisation de relais électromagnétiques et de
systèmes pneumatiques pour la réalisation des parties de
commandes. Les inconvénients : cher, pas de flexibilité, pas de
communication possible.
▪ Logique programmée:
La solution c’est l’utilisation des systèmes à base de
microprocesseurs permettant une modification aisée des
systèmes automatisés.
Pr. Kamal BOTROS 01
ACCEPTION
Automatique Automatisation Automatisme
C’est l’ensemble des sciences et C’est l’exécution automatique des C’est un système automatisé qui
techniques utilisées dans la tâches ou plusieurs sous-tâches inclut l’ensemble des éléments qui
conception et la réalisation des sans l’intervention humaine. effectue des actions sans
systèmes automatisés. l’intervention de l’operateur (celui
qui peut donner des ordres de
départ ou d’arrêt si besoin.)
Pr. Kamal BOTROS 02
DEFINITION
Un Automate Programmable Industriel (API), en anglais, Programmable Logic Controller (PLC) est une machine
électronique programmable par un personnel automaticien et destiné à piloter en ambiance industrielle et en temps
réel des procédés ou parties opératives.
Avantages des API :
▪ Amélioration de production avec une qualité
▪ L’asservissement, la régulation des grandeurs physiques
OUTPUTS
▪ Changement de production suite au besoin
▪ Facilité de la maintenance technique suite à une supervision
▪ Amélioration de la sécurité humaine et matérielle
▪ la réduction d’espace et des coûts de câblage
Tous ces avantages sont à la fois humains, techniques et économiques.
INPUTS PLC
Pr. Kamal BOTROS 03
Chapitre 1 : Systèmes automatisés
A. Structure d’un système automatisé
Dans l'ère moderne, les systèmes automatisés jouent un rôle fondamental en remodelant notre mode de vie. Ces
innovations technologiques sophistiquées, déployées dans des domaines variés tels que la production industrielle, la
gestion des ressources, et même nos foyers, ont apporté une transformation significative. En simplifiant des tâches
autrefois laborieuses, ces systèmes ont libéré du temps, amélioré l'efficacité opérationnelle et ouvert la voie à une
nouvelle ère de progrès technologique.
Tous les systèmes automatisés de production (SAP) est généralement défini par trois parties :
▪ la partie opérative (PO)
▪ la partie commande (PC)
▪ la partie relation (PR)
Consignes Ordres
Compte
Pr. Kamal BOTROS
Signaux rendus 04
Chapitre 1 : Systèmes automatisés
A. Structure d’un système automatisé
A.1. Partie Opérative
C’est la partie qui permet de réaliser les mouvements et les actions sur le produit, elle représente l’ensemble des
dispositifs :
▪ Pré-actionneurs (distributeurs, contacteurs…) qui reçoivent des ordres de la partie commande.
▪ Actionneurs (vérins pneumatiques ou hydrauliques, moteurs, vannes…) qui ont pour rôle d’exécuter les ordres.
▪ Capteurs qui ont pour rôle est de contrôler, mesurer, surveiller et envoyer des signaux à la partie commande.
Pr. Kamal BOTROS 05
Chapitre 1 : Systèmes automatisés
A. Structure d’un système automatisé
A.2. Partie Commande
C’est la partie qui permet de gérer, d’organiser l’enchainement des actions, des mouvements du système. Elle
regroupe les constituants et les composants destinés au traitement des informations (signaux) émises par les capteurs
machines de la (P.O) et les capteurs opérateurs de la (P.R).
Dans l’industrie, elle existe sous :
▪ Armoire électrique
▪ Carte intelligente
▪ Micro ordinateur
▪ Régulateur PID
▪ API
Pr. Kamal BOTROS 06
Chapitre 1 : Systèmes automatisés
A. Structure d’un système automatisé
A.3. Partie Relation
C’est la partie qui permet le dialogue entre l’homme et la machine, elle regroupe les capteurs opérateurs et les
composants de signalisation visuels et/ou sonores.
Le pupitre de commande sert comme support aux éléments de la (P.R).
Pr. Kamal BOTROS 07
Chapitre 1 : Systèmes automatisés
B. Fonctions principales d’un API
1. Contrôle des processus : Les automates programmables sont conçus pour contrôler des processus industriels en
séquence, en gérant des entrées et des sorties.
2. Programmation : Permet la programmation d'instructions logiques afin de définir le comportement de l'automate
dans différentes situations.
3. Gestion des entrées/sorties : Facilite la connexion à des capteurs et actionneurs pour interagir avec le monde
extérieur.
4. Synchronisation : Exécute des tâches de manière séquentielle, suivant le programme logique établi.
5. Flexibilité : Possibilité de reprogrammer l'automate pour s'adapter à de nouveaux processus ou exigences.
6. Fiabilité : Offre une fiabilité élevée pour des opérations continues dans des environnements industriels.
7. Surveillance : Peut inclure des fonctionnalités de surveillance et de diagnostic pour faciliter la maintenance et le
dépannage.
8. Interface utilisateur : Peut permettre une interface utilisateur pour la configuration et la supervision des opérations.
Pr. Kamal BOTROS 08
Chapitre 2 : Automate programmable
A. Types d’automates
Il existe différents types d’automates programmables, chacun adapté à des applications spécifiques. Mais généralement
ils sont repartis en deux catégories :
▪ API Compact
▪ API Modulaire
Pr. Kamal BOTROS 09
Chapitre 2 : Automate programmable
A. Types d’automates
A.1. API Compact
Un automate compact ou MONOBLOC est un automate limité par un nombre de d’entrées / sorties, donc l’utilisation
d’un API monobloc nécessite l’étude parfaite d’un cahier de charge donné, car le manque d’une E/S nécessite l’extension
d'un bloc, ou prix d’un notre API.
Siemens EATON Schneider Crouzet
LOGO EC4P ZELIO Millenium
Pr. Kamal BOTROS 10
Chapitre 2 : Automate programmable
A. Types d’automates
A.2. API Modulaire
Un automate modulaire est un automate composé de modules individuels qui peuvent être ajoutés, retirés ou remplacés
selon les besoins spécifiques du cahier de charge.
Ces modules peuvent inclure des entrées/sorties, des unités de traitement, des interfaces de communication, etc.
L'automate modulaire offre une flexibilité et une évolutivité accrues par rapport aux automates traditionnels, car il
permet aux utilisateurs de personnaliser et d'adapter facilement le système en fonction des exigences de leur processus.
Siemens Schneider HITACHI
S7-300 MODICON M340 EH-150
Pr. Kamal BOTROS 11
Chapitre 2 : Automate programmable
B. Architecture d’un API
Pour comprendre pleinement le fonctionnement d’un API, il est essentiel d'explorer sa structure interne. Cette
Architecture, composée de divers éléments, façonne la manière dont les requêtes sont traitées, les données sont
manipulées et les réponses sont générées. Ses principaux composants sont :
1. L’unité centrale de traitement
2. L’alimentation
3. Les modules d’entrée / sortie
4. Cartes E/S Déportées
5. Rack
Pr. Kamal BOTROS 12
Chapitre 2 : Automate programmable
B. Architecture d’un API
B.1. Unité centrale de traitement ‘CPU’
‘UCT’ en français, ‘CPU’ en anglais (Central Processing Unit), est l’élément qui permet le traitement des fonctions
logiques, arithmétiques, mathématiques et scientifiques. Elle est définie par :
▪ Microprocesseur : il traite les fonctions précédentes à base de ‘UAL’ (Unité Arithmétique Logique)
▪ RAM : la mémoire vive caractérisée par la capacité et le format de la donnée, utilisable en lecture-écriture des
données pendant le fonctionnement .
▪ ROM : mémoire morte qui permet de sauvegarder un programme pour une application industrielle exécutée à
chaque démarrage, utilisée pour stocké le programme, de type EEPROM (Electrique, Effaçable et Programmable)
▪ Bus : représenté par les bus de données, adresses, et contrôles.
Pr. Kamal BOTROS 13
Chapitre 2 : Automate programmable
B. Architecture d’un API
B.2. Alimentation
‘PS’ (Power Supply) est un bloc qui permet de générer les différentes sources de tension sous différentes puissances;
Les automates programmables nécessitent généralement une alimentation de 24v DC.
On fait appel aux alimentations stabilisées et les alimentations à découpage.
Pr. Kamal BOTROS 14
Chapitre 2 : Automate programmable
B. Architecture d’un API
B.3. Modules d’ E/S
C’est la seule interface physique entre les dispositifs d’ E/S et CPU. Ils sont repartis en deux sortes :
▪ Modules E/S TOR (tout ou rien) : module qui représente l’information d’un dispositif E/S que par un bit à deux niveaux
logiques 0 ou 1.
▪ Modules E/S Analogiques : module qui permet de traiter l ‘information des grandeurs E/S par des mots binaires après
une chaine de mesure analogique ou numérique du capteur.
Les grandeurs analogiques sont normalisées : 0-10V ou 4-20mA
Le nombre des entrées est des sorties varie suivant le type d’automate entre 8, 16 ou 32 voies.
Pr. Kamal BOTROS 15